Drivers Are Keeping Their Vehicles Longer Than Ever

The average ownership period of a new vehicle in the United States is now 8.4 years, with some models being held 9.7 to 11.4 years. This average has increased roughly 23% since the late 2000s, when most drivers kept vehicles for about 5 to 6 years. Today,
